GoCanvas, SiteDocs, and Bluebeam work together as part of the Nemetschek Group to streamline construction and field operations. GoCanvas specializes in digital fieldworker collaboration and compliance, while SiteDocs, a GoCanvas solution, focuses on workplace safety management through mobile and web apps. Bluebeam enhances these capabilities by providing powerful workflow automation and seamless integrations, allowing teams to connect data, automate processes, and keep field and office teams in sync. Together, these platforms create a unified ecosystem that improves efficiency, safety, and collaboration across construction projects.
SiteDocs is seeking a Senior Engineering Manager to join their team! As a Senior Engineering Manager, you’ll lead and grow high-performing engineering teams while overseeing delivery across a mix of full-time staff and external vendor partners. You will shape the technical direction, execution strategy, and team health across one or more product lines. This role blends hands-on team leadership with broader organizational influence—partnering with Product, Design, and cross-functional stakeholders to deliver scalable, high-quality software.
You’ll work across boundaries—between internal and external teams, across product lines, and within a broader multi-brand environment—while elevating engineering culture, execution, and ownership.
Your Most Important Initiatives:
- Team Leadership & Development
- Lead 1–2 cross-functional teams, including oversight of external contractors or vendor relationships.
- Hire, onboard, and develop engineers; foster a culture of growth, accountability, and continuous improvement.
- Conduct regular 1:1s, provide coaching and feedback, and support career development across the team.
- Technical Strategy & Execution
- Shape and communicate technical vision in partnership with Engineering and Product leadership.
- Ensure technical quality in deliverables, code health, and architectural alignment with long-term platform goals.
- Drive planning and execution for product initiatives, balancing internal and vendor contributions.
- Collaboration & Stakeholder Communication
- Partner with Product, Design, and Go-To-Market teams to align delivery with business needs.
- Represent Engineering in leadership forums, translating between technical and non-technical audiences.
- Drive alignment in multi-brand or integration contexts, ensuring transparency and momentum.
- Process Improvement & Performance Monitoring
- Implement and evolve engineering workflows using agile methodologies while keeping process lean and purpose-driven.
- Track key engineering KPIs.
- Continuously refine team execution, culture, and system-level resilience through structured improvements.
- Innovation & Technical Oversight
- Stay current on relevant technologies and industry trends.
- Support technical exploration, R&D, and architectural experimentation that aligns with business priorities.
- Own operational excellence: system scalability, performance, and reliability.
What You Bring:
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field (or equivalent experience).
- 7+ years of experience in software engineering, including 3+ years managing teams.
- Experience managing distributed teams and external vendor or contractor relationships.
- Strong technical background in modern software development practices, architecture, and infrastructure.
- Proven ability to lead through ambiguity and drive clarity across multiple product lines or organizations.
- Excellent communication skills for cross-functional leadership, conflict resolution, and influence.
- High emotional intelligence and a track record of building strong, inclusive team cultures.
